ClawRecipes
ClawRecipes предоставляет готовые шаблоны в формате Markdown для быстрого создания полноценных команд агентов OpenClaw, ориентированных на файловую структуру, с предопределенными ролями, гибкими рабочими процессами и повторяющейся автоматизацией по расписанию (cron).
Что такое ClawRecipes?
Что такое ClawRecipes?
ClawRecipes — это мощное расширение для фреймворка OpenClaw, разработанное для устранения утомительного процесса ручной настройки команд ИИ-агентов. Вместо «взлома агентов» пользователи могут использовать структурированные шаблоны Markdown — называемые «рецептами» — для мгновенного создания полных, согласованных и функциональных рабочих пространств агентов. Эта система навязывает философию «сначала файлы», гарантируя, что контекст, рабочие процессы и конфигурации команд контролируются версиями, подлежат проверке и могут быть воспроизведены.
Это решение переводит настройку команды из хрупкого, скрытого управления состоянием в прозрачную инфраструктуру, удобную для Git. Применив рецепт, вы немедленно устанавливаете общий контекст (например, документацию и тикеты), определяете специализированных агентов в стиле «коллег» (Руководитель, Разработчик, QA), фиксируете структуры гибких рабочих процессов (плавающие дорожки) и интегрируете повторяющуюся автоматизацию через задания cron. Результатом является детерминированная, высококачественная настройка, которая от первоначального шаблона до выполненной работы обеспечивает постоянство каждый раз.
Ключевые возможности
- Шаблоны Markdown: Определяйте всю структуру команды, репозитории контекста и рабочие процессы с помощью читаемых файлов Markdown, что делает конфигурацию прозрачной и поддающейся аудиту.
- Контекст «Сначала файлы» (Кладовая): Вся критически важная информация команды — заметки, тикеты, контрольные списки и артефакты — находится в общем рабочем пространстве с контролем версий, гарантируя, что агенты никогда не «забудут» важный контекст.
- Агенты в стиле «Коллеги» (Линия): Создавайте шаблоны специализированных ролей (например, Руководитель, Разработчик, DevOps, QA), которые действуют с определенными обязанностями, инструментами и шаблонами, позволяя пользователям взаимодействовать с ними как с выделенными членами команды.
- Автоматизированные циклы рабочего процесса (Таймер): Внедряйте повторяющиеся задачи, такие как ежедневная сортировка, гигиена доски или отслеживание PR, используя рабочие процессы cron, определенные в рецептах. Они активируются по желанию и контролируются подсказками для обеспечения безопасности.
- Принудительное применение гибкого процесса (Передача): Автоматически настраивайте структурированные гибкие дорожки (Бэклог, В работе, Тестирование, Готово) с четкой передачей задач и контрольными списками верификации, встроенными непосредственно в структуру рабочего процесса.
- Детерминированное создание шаблонов: Гарантируйте, что каждая новая команда начинает работу с заведомо хорошей структуры, со всеми предопределенными ролями, шаблонами и соглашениями, обеспечивая согласованность проектов.
Как использовать ClawRecipes
Начало работы с ClawRecipes включает интеграцию его в вашу существующую среду OpenClaw, а затем применение желаемого рецепта для построения структуры вашей команды.
1. Установка: Сначала установите плагин в вашу настройку OpenClaw через терминал:
$openclaw plugins install @jiggai/recipes
После установки необходимо перезапустить шлюз OpenClaw для активации новой функциональности:
$openclaw gateway restart
2. Создание шаблона команды или агента:
После установки вы можете использовать команду scaffold-team для развертывания полной, предварительно настроенной среды на основе рецепта. Например, для настройки стандартной команды разработки:
$openclaw recipes scaffold-team development-team -t my-dev-team --apply-config
В качестве альтернативы, если вам нужен только один специализированный агент, вы можете создать его шаблон напрямую:
$openclaw recipes scaffold researcher --agent-id my-researcher --apply-config
3. Просмотр и итерация: Поскольку все конфигурации основаны на файлах, вы можете немедленно просмотреть сгенерированную структуру рабочего пространства, изучить роли агентов и изменить гибкие дорожки или задания cron в вашей системе контроля версий, прежде чем полностью развертывать или запускать агентов.
Сценарии использования
- Быстрый запуск проектов: Мгновенное развертывание стандартизированных сред разработки для новых проектов. Рецепт может обеспечить соблюдение общекорпоративных стандартов для контрольных списков обзора кода, процедур развертывания (роль DevOps) и начальной структуры документации, гарантируя, что ни один критический шаг настройки не будет пропущен.
- Автоматизированные исследования и отчетность: Разверните команду, центрированную вокруг агента-Исследователя, поддерживаемого агентом QA. Используйте функцию cron для планирования ежедневной агрегации данных или задач мониторинга рынка, предоставляя последовательные, повторяемые отчеты без ручного вмешательства.
- Обеспечение дисциплины Agile: Для команд, испытывающих трудности с соблюдением процесса, ClawRecipe может зафиксировать строгий гибкий поток (Диспетчеризация -> Бэклог -> В работе -> Тестирование -> Готово). Сама структура направляет агентов и человеческих участников к правильной передаче задач и шагам верификации.
- Ввод в должность новых разработчиков: Новые члены команды могут клонировать репозиторий, содержащий конфигурацию ClawRecipe проекта. Это немедленно настраивает их локальную среду OpenClaw с теми же ожиданиями в отношении ролей агентов, файлов контекста и рабочего процесса, что и у остальной команды.
- Поддержание рабочих процессов «Инфраструктура как код» (IaC): Используйте рецепты для определения агентов, ответственных за управление инфраструктурой (DevOps). Их контекст может включать шаблоны IaC, а их рабочие процессы могут быть настроены на запуск автоматических проверок безопасности или циклов верификации развертывания по расписанию.
FAQ
В: Бесплатно ли использовать ClawRecipes с OpenClaw?
О: ClawRecipes представлен как открытый плагин (@jiggai/recipes) для OpenClaw. Хотя сам плагин, как правило, является открытым исходным кодом и бесплатен для установки, затраты на использование зависят от базовой инфраструктуры шлюза OpenClaw и поставщиков LLM, которых вы используете.
В: Как мне настроить роли, определенные в рецепте (например, изменить инструменты агента Dev)? О: Поскольку рецепты используют шаблоны на основе файлов, вы можете просмотреть сгенерированные файлы после развертывания. Вы можете напрямую изменить определения агентов (инструменты, шаблоны, обязанности) в сгенерированных конфигурационных файлах в вашем рабочем пространстве и зафиксировать эти изменения в системе контроля версий.
В: Что произойдет, если задание cron, определенное в рецепте, запустится неожиданно? О: ClawRecipes ставит в приоритет безопасность. Задания Cron, предлагаемые рецептом, устанавливаются только после явного согласия пользователя через подсказку. Они не активируются автоматически при создании шаблона, что предотвращает нежелательные фоновые операции.
В: Могу ли я поделиться своими пользовательскими настройками команд с другими? О: Абсолютно. Основное преимущество подхода «сначала файлы» — возможность совместного использования. Вы можете зафиксировать измененные файлы рецепта или полученную структуру рабочего пространства в Git и поделиться ею с любым другим пользователем OpenClaw, у которого установлен плагин ClawRecipes.
В: Что делать, если мне нужна роль, не включенная в стандартные рецепты (например, выделенный агент по маркетингу)? О: Вы можете расширить существующие рецепты или создать новые. Система позволяет определять пользовательские роли, назначать им конкретные инструменты и шаблоны и интегрировать их в существующие гибкие дорожки, обеспечивая удовлетворение ваших специализированных потребностей в рамках структурированной основы.
Alternatives
AakarDev AI
AakarDev AI — это мощная платформа, которая упрощает разработку приложений ИИ с бесшовной интеграцией векторных баз данных, позволяя быстрое развертывание и масштабируемость.
LobeHub
LobeHub — это платформа с открытым исходным кодом, предназначенная для создания, развертывания и совместной работы с командами ИИ-агентов, функционирующая как универсальный веб-интерфейс для LLM.
Claude Opus 4.5
Представляем лучшую модель в мире для кодирования, агентов, использования компьютеров и корпоративных рабочих процессов.
KiloClaw
KiloClaw — это полностью управляемый, размещенный сервис для развертывания OpenClaw, популярного агента на базе ИИ с открытым исходным кодом, который устраняет сложность самостоятельного хостинга инфраструктуры и обслуживания.
Dify
Разблокируйте агентский рабочий процесс с Dify. Разрабатывайте, развертывайте и управляйте автономными агентами, RAG-пайплайнами и многим другим для команд любого масштаба без усилий.
BookAI.chat
BookAI позволяет вам общаться с вашими книгами, просто предоставив название и автора.